About this item

  • BRIGHT & DISTINCTIVE: Solid Sitka spruce top with round soundhole provides that bell-bright attack and distinctive Celtic sound
  • CRISP & RESONANT: Solid maple back and sides produce crisp high notes and resonant mid range tones
  • FAST & STABLE: Slim mahogany neck offers fast, easy action and inherently long-lasting stability
  • SMOOTH PLAYABILITY: Choice Santos rosewood fingerboard ensures silky smooth playability
  • TRADITIONAL ELEGANCE: Elegant abalone Celtic design peghead inlay for a traditional feel
  • PREMIUM PROTECTION: Deluxe ProTour gig bag with Trinity College logo included

Date First Available April 13, 2004 Back Material Maple Body Material Maple Color Name Natural Top Fretboard Material Rosewood Scale Length 20 3/8 inch String Material Alloy Steel Top Material Spruce Neck Material Type Mahogany Number of Strings 8

The Trinity College TM-325 Octave Mandolin is designed for traditional Celtic music though they are used un a wide variety of other styles as well.Top quality , all solid wood construction. The traditional style body is complemented by an elegant snakehead peghead with distinctive abalone inlay in the black and white overlay. This fine instrument has a Natural Finish

when you open the box you will be impressed!! no drip makes, no thick varnish, no over gluing on the inside. what it does have is great wood, x bracing, well made fret board, and great tuners. this is a WELL made instrument for the money and more than likely the best for the price range. but i would feel bad is i didnt tell you about the down sides. you need to set up the mandolin. this means set up the bridge, maybe adjust the truss rod, and maybe filing the bridge. so i would tell you to have it professionally set up(dont worry its only like $30-$50). the tailpiece, while nice, is not as good as it could be, but they can be changed out very easily and available online ($30-$200, the cheaper ones will work perfect, should say "cast", and the more expensive are gold plated and things like that to make them expensive). at the end of the day, you will be very happy with this mandolin.
